Output 03bd3375f6a92a4ef0d53eaeb745af07c83105922374f6726e27c5ebe8ae9210:47

value
106339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d7663c48023e11f69683ad3b5a1eaf1f20aa57 OP_EQUAL
address
3BFNEhmy9YSZuKqyyGjEsjefPkbvCfQb3t
transaction
03bd3375f6a92a4ef0d53eaeb745af07c83105922374f6726e27c5ebe8ae9210
confirmations
282199
spent
true